Real Reviews From Verified Customers

Long Island City, NY 11101
Distance: 10.8 mi.
New York, NY 10021
Distance: 10.8 mi.
Flushing, NY 11377
Distance: 10.8 mi.
Jamaica, NY 11416
Distance: 10.9 mi.
Jamaica, NY 11416
Distance: 10.9 mi.
Jamaica, NY 11416
Distance: 10.9 mi.
Flushing, NY 11377
Distance: 10.9 mi.
Jamaica, NY 11417
Distance: 10.9 mi.
Astoria, NY 11106
Distance: 10.9 mi.
Jamaica, NY 11417
Distance: 10.9 mi.
Union City, NJ 07087
Distance: 10.9 mi.
North Bergen, NJ 07047
Distance: 10.9 mi.
5 out of 5
1 Review
Jamaica, NY 11414
Distance: 10.9 mi.
Ozone Park, NY 11417
Distance: 10.9 mi.
Jamaica, NY 11417
Distance: 10.9 mi.
Jamaica, NY 11416
Distance: 10.9 mi.